Job DetailsJob Location: Remote - Canada - Calgary, AB T2A 6W9Position Type: Full TimeRRC is seeking a talented Substation Designer (Physical) P&C to help us build the future of both U.S. and Canada energy production from both remote work locations and any one of our U.S. or Canadian office locations. RRC is a multi-disciplinary engineering firm that specializes in energy projects, particularly renewable energy, throughout the United States. Founded in 2007, RRC provides a culture where employees are valued while contributing to meaningful projects. This is an opportunity to work at the forefront of the evolving energy production landscape.   RRC CORE VALUES   Must understand and personify RRC’s core values: Client Satisfaction – understands the goal of always exceeding our client’s expectations  Employee Happiness – able to work well with others, communicate clearly with coworkers, promote a positive work environment, and mediate conflicts between team members Quality Work - able to take ownership, work independently, prioritize workload, and deliver quality results on time while working on multiple projects simultaneously Above and Beyond - versatile, flexible, able to anticipate the needs of the company, take the initiative, and willing to go out of your way to assist others   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ES   Complete substation (Air & GIS) switchyard design packages encompassing operating single line diagrams, layouts, sections, bus calculation/selections, ground grid, cable tray/trench/duct bank, lighting, lightning protection, prefabricated control building layouts, AC/DC station service supply, voltage drop, conduit/cable tray fill, bill of materials, etc.   Complete substation protection and control design packages including single line diagrams, three-line diagrams, schematics, wiring diagrams, panel layouts, etc.  Complete renewable energy collector system design packages such as medium voltage systems with switchgear, transformers, AC/DC inverters and power cables, AC/DC distribution systems, PV plants, battery energy storage systems, and wind turbines for both wind and solar projects  Interface with internal and external team members including electrical engineers, electrical designers, drafters, project managers, and take ownership of the project to meet and exceed client expectations.  Support development of standards, optimizations, and processes and provide execution plans with strong follow-through   M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S (K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ES) Minimum of diploma or bachelors degree in drafting / electrical design   5+ years related experience in AutoCAD, MicroStation, Civil3D, and/or AutoCAD Map3D in power delivery (transmission and distribution systems for utilities or industrial), renewable energy, or power generation   Strong CAD skills with experience utilizing layers, blocks, XREFs, coordinate systems, annotations, and dimensioning while abiding by company and industry drafting standards  Must be authorized for full-time work in Canada  Ability to work on multi-discipline projects  Excellent time management and organization skills  Excellent computer skills; proficient in MS Word, Excel, Outlook with advanced MS Office skills  Excellent communication and interpersonal skills including the ability to work cross-functionally to understand requirements, present alternatives, and make recommendations  Ability to collaborate within a team environment  Self-motivated and work with minimal guidance  3D Modeling experience a plus  Experience with PVcase, PVCAD a plus  Knowledge of renewable energy industry relating to utility scale wind and solar projects, such as MV power systems and AC/DC distribution system a plus  Experience with Battery Energy Storage Systems a plus  Understanding of applicable industry codes and standards including the ANSI/IEEE, NESC, NEC, CSA a plus  Manufacturer experience of power transformer, circuit breaker, AIS/GIS switchgear, AC/DC inverter, etc. a plus      BENEFITS    RRC is committed to investing in talented employees because we recognize that healthy, happy employees provide the best path to sustaining a successful business.
